When you consume Essences of Luck, you increase your Magic Find:https://wiki.guildwars2.com/wiki/Magic_Find

300 is the maximum you can reach by consuming said Essences, you can gain additional Magic Find through Achievements and Achievements Chests rewarded for leveling your Account Points. Open the Hero Panel and select the Achievement tab, then scroll down to the right to see your current values (hover over them for further details).

@marz at play.9624 said:Thank you. What do you do with the Essence of Luck after you hit 300 magic find? Sell it? How does having 300 magic find benefit me?

Save it. You can donate it to Guilds that are leveling up Halls, or donate to a guild for decorations OR you can also save it up and each year during Lunar new year you can use it to buy things off certain merchants and do achievements.

It takes ALLOT to reach 300%. After a while iirc it takes about 30k Luck for each percent increase. Also Magic find canbe CRAZY high with boosts for what its worth. SilverWastes map gives 3 stacking magic find boosts + you can get many other boosts. with 300% MF + all the boosts you can get Magic find all the way up over 1100 Magic (not a typo).

you can reach cap magic find if you work for it: buy ectoplasm, salvage it, consume the magic essences acquired and sell back the acquired dust, repeat until it gets maxed, and it won't even cost you much.

I've only regularly play and level my magic find, and despite hundreds of gameplay hours, just recently I reached 250% magic find.

To OP, what good is magic find for? For the most part it functions at mob kill time to determine the quality of the loot. At higher values, the player will significantly see more yellow drops rather than greens or blues. It doesn't apply when opening loot bags, though (unless otherwise specified by the item's description).

Yeah, pretty much just effects monster drops mostly..

Boss chests, fractal loot, meta rewards, opening champ bags and unidentified gear.. doesn't effect any of that stuff which is what 99.9% of all the good loot in the game is mostly found in and where Magic Find would actually be useful.

The only exceptions are Silverwastes chestsDivine Lucky EnvelopesAnd a small number of containers specifically named loot box or cache from HoT and reward tracks which actually state they are effected by magic find.

The MF% is misleading as well, having 300% MF doesn't mean you are 3 times more likely to get good loot.. apprently you need 1000% magic find to double your chances.300% really isn't all that much of an improvement over none at all..And then there's the fact that MF only effects loot tables! not what's actually in those tables so even if you get lucky and roll high thanks to MF and your loot has the potential for super rare and valuable loot, vast majority of the time you're still going to end up with trash rares or some worthless exotic that doesn't even hit 80s on the trading post.

So yeah.. Magic Find is basically a trash feature of Gw2 that serves very little use anymore outside of Silverwastes farming and lunar new year festival.It's not worth buying ecto to max it imo
